Erica’s Reviews > Leech > Status Update

Erica
Erica is on page 175 of 323
Feb 09, 2026 08:14AM
Leech

flag

Erica’s Previous Updates

Erica
Erica is on page 240 of 323
10 hours, 43 min ago
Leech


Erica
Erica is on page 208 of 323
Feb 09, 2026 05:41PM
Leech


Erica
Erica is on page 163 of 323
Feb 08, 2026 10:34AM
Leech


Erica
Erica is on page 152 of 323
Feb 08, 2026 09:17AM
Leech


Erica
Erica is on page 140 of 323
Feb 08, 2026 08:47AM
Leech


Erica
Erica is on page 131 of 323
Jul 09, 2024 06:05PM
Leech


No comments have been added yet.